Option C: The "New" Indexing – Plex & Jellyfin
Instead of searching for insecure web servers, build your own media server.
- Buy the DVD/Blu-ray of Teeth.
- Rip it using MakeMKV (legal for personal backup in many countries).
- Use FileBot to rename the file
Teeth (2007).mkv. - Host it on a Plex server.
This gives you the organized "Index" aesthetic without breaking the law. "Index Of Teeth Movie": A Deep Dive into
Physical Media (For Collectors)
If you want the "index of" feeling of ownership without the crime, buy the Blu-ray.
- Lionsgate Vestron Video Collector's Series (Region A): Comes with directors commentary, deleted scenes (including an alternate ending), and a making-of documentary called The Menace Within.
- Arrow Video (Region B): A UK release with superior compression.
